最新蜘蛛池搭建技术教程
蜘蛛池是一种用于网络爬虫的技术,它可以帮助我们更高效地获取网页数据,并进行分析和处理。最新的蜘蛛池搭建技术可以让我们更好地利用这个工具,下面就让我来为大家介绍一下吧!
首先,什么是蜘蛛池呢?蜘蛛池就相当于一群网络爬虫,它们可以同时工作,快速抓取大量的网页数据。这样我们就可以在短时间内获取到更多有用的信息。
在搭建蜘蛛池之前,我们需要准备一些工具和环境。首先,我们需要选择一个合适的编程语言,比如Python,因为Python有丰富的爬虫库可以供我们使用。其次,我们需要安装相应的软件,比如Python的开发环境Anaconda和便捷的代码编辑器。
在开始编写代码之前,我们需要先了解一些基本的概念。首先是请求和响应。请求是指我们向服务器发送的获取数据的请求,响应则是服务器返回给我们的数据。在蜘蛛池中,我们需要编写代码来发送请求并处理响应。
接下来,我们需要学习一些常用的爬虫库,比如Requests和BeautifulSoup。Requests可以帮助我们发送请求并获取响应,而BeautifulSoup可以帮助我们解析网页数据,提取出我们需要的信息。
在编写代码之前,我们还需要了解一些基本的爬虫原则。首先是尊重网站的规则,不要频繁地发送请求,以免给服务器造成过大的负担。其次是合理地设置请求头,模拟真实的用户行为,避免被网站屏蔽。最后是处理异常情况,比如网络连接失败或者网页解析错误,我们需要编写相应的代码来应对这些情况。
现在,让我们来编写代码吧!首先,我们需要导入相关的库,比如Requests和BeautifulSoup。然后,我们可以定义一个函数,用于发送请求并获取响应。接着,我们需要编写代码来解析网页数据,提取出我们需要的信息,并进行相应的处理。
在编写代码的过程中,我们可以利用循环和多线程的技术,来实现蜘蛛池的并发工作。这样可以大大提高我们的爬取效率,更快地获取到我们想要的数据。
当然,在搭建蜘蛛池之前,我们还需要考虑一些额外的因素。比如,我们需要选择合适的代理服务器,以防止被网站屏蔽。我们还需要考虑数据存储和处理的问题,比如将数据保存到数据库或者导出成Excel文件。
总结一下,最新的蜘蛛池搭建技术可以帮助我们更高效地获取网页数据。通过选择合适的编程语言和库,了解基本的爬虫原则,以及熟练运用相关的技术,我们可以轻松地搭建一个强大的蜘蛛池,帮助我们进行数据采集和分析。
希望这篇文章对大家有所帮助!祝大家在蜘蛛池的搭建过程中取得好的成果!